What is a direct result of having greenhouse gases in the atmosphere? a. releasing radiation into space b. melting glaciers c. d

epleting the ozone layer d. trapping the sun's energy in the atmosphere

Option (d) trapping the sun's energy in the atmosphere is the correct answer.

A direct result of having greenhouse gases in the atmosphere is trapping the sun's energy in the atmosphere that causes global warming.

<h3>How are the greenhouse gases responsible for the climate change?</h3>

Greenhouse gases are responsible for global warming because they retain heat that would otherwise escape from the atmosphere, greenhouse gases are to blame for global warming. These gases, as opposed to oxygen and nitrogen, are able to absorb radiation and retain heat.

Earth is kept at a temperature where life can exist because to greenhouse gases. The Earth would be far too cold without greenhouse gases for the majority of life as we know it. On the other hand, if the concentration of these gases is too high, the greenhouse effect will become unmanageable and lead to an unacceptably hot global temperature.

The correct answer is D. The deepest parts of the oceans, located near the continents, are the oceanic trenches.

Explanation:

The ocean trenches are large depressions at the base of the seabed, which constitute the deepest parts of the Earth. Of these, the Mariana Trench, located in the Pacific Ocean to the east of China, is the deepest, being approximately 11,000 meters deep.

These trenches are formed by the activity of tectonic plates, specifically when one plate moves below the other and by the force exerted a depression is generated in the seabed, followed by a chain of volcanic islands at a close distance.

Which countries in south asia have capitals that are centrally located
Katena32 [7]

Answer:

Bangladesh

Nepal

Explanation:

There are eight countries that fall into the region of South Asia. Out of these eight countries, only two have centrally located capitals. Those two countries are Bangladesh and Nepal. Bangladesh's capital is Dhaka, and it is located in the central part of the country. It is the most populated city in the country, and it is also one of the places in the world with highest population densities. Kathmandu is the capital of Nepal. Nepal doesn't really have a shape so that a city can be far away from the borders, but if we look at it in a longitudinal manner, its capital comes to be in the central part of the country. It is by far the most populated city in the country, and it is the political, economic, cultural, administrative center.
